IN THE U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T WESTERN DISTRICT OF ARKANSAS HOT SPRINGS DIVISION KRISTIN HILL BRASSER KUELBS and THE IRREVOCABLE TRUST OF KRISTIN N. KUELBS v. Civil No. 08-6110 PLAINTIFFS KIMBERLY HILL, JEFFREY HILL, CAROL HILL, LYNN (HILL) WELK, LAWRENCE WELK, JR.; RYAN BENSON, AMERICAN CENTURY SERVICES, LLC.; AMERICAN CENTURY INVESTMENTS, RITA ABERNATHY, ANN TUTTLE and JOHN DOES 1-10 DEFENDANTS ORDER Currently before the Court are the Motion for Sanctions against Donald Hill (Doc. 60) filed by Separate Defendants Kimberly Hill, Jeffrey Hill, Carol Hill, Lynn Welk, Lawrence Welk, Jr. and the Motion to Hold Donald C. Hill Personally Liable for Excessive Attorneys' Fees Under 28 U.S.C. § 1927 (Doc. 63) filed by Separate Defendant American Century Services, LLC. On July 15, 2009, Plaintiffs filed a notice of appeal in connection with the Court's Order and Judgment dismissing this matter (Docs. 58-59). Accordingly, the motions are DENIED at this time, however, the defendants may renew them following the appeal. AO72A (Rev. 8/82) IT IS SO ORDERED this 16th day of July 2009. /s/ Robert T.
